FPSA - Monkfish liver recalled because of undeclared milk allergen

Summary by FPSA
JJWV Marketing Corporation of Santa Fe Springs, CA, is recalling its Ankimo Monkfish Liver because of an undeclared milk allergen. The product may contain milk, posing a serious or life-threatening risk to individuals with milk allergies or sensitivities.
